Fairview Park plans to move forward in 2012

Mayor Eileen Patton of Fairview says that 2012 presents a good opportunity for the city to move forward and achieve some goals. The mayor reports financial rollovers going into 2012 that will assist in creating programs, providing services and continuing with redevelopment projects.

A number of redevelopment projects are currently underway, including the construction of an assisted living and nursing home facility. Also in the works is the development of the United Telephone Credit Union offices located where the former Cleveland Motel was on 22735 Lorain Road. Yet another redevelopment program currently underway in Fairview Park is the improvements and renovations to the Fairview Center, commonly referred to as the Fairview Shopping Center.

Other plans for Fairview Park in 2012 include sewer projects, street projects and repair of the aging infrastructure. In addition to the approximately $2 million that flows into the sewer fund each year, the city has also applied for 2 grants to further fund these and other projects. These grants total almost $1 million to supplement the projects in 2012.
